Skip to content
Snippets Groups Projects
Commit 81e8f9dc authored by Lars Bilke's avatar Lars Bilke
Browse files

[ci] Enabled container job on release branch.

parent b0baaa4d
No related branches found
No related tags found
No related merge requests found
...@@ -7,18 +7,20 @@ container: ...@@ -7,18 +7,20 @@ container:
- if: $CI_COMMIT_TAG - if: $CI_COMMIT_TAG
- changes: - changes:
- scripts/ci/jobs/container.yml - scripts/ci/jobs/container.yml
- if: $CI_COMMIT_BRANCH =~ /^v[0-9]\.[0-9]\.[0-9]/
- when: manual - when: manual
allow_failure: true allow_failure: true
extends: extends:
- .container-maker-setup - .container-maker-setup
script: script:
- docker login -u $CI_REGISTRY_USER -p $CI_REGISTRY_PASSWORD $CI_REGISTRY - docker login -u $CI_REGISTRY_USER -p $CI_REGISTRY_PASSWORD $CI_REGISTRY
- if [[ "$CI_COMMIT_BRANCH" == "master" ]] ;then export DOCKER_TAG="--tag $CI_REGISTRY/ogs/$CI_PROJECT_NAME/ogs-serial:latest" ; fi
- > - >
poetry run ogscm compiler.py ogs.py -B -C -R --ogs ../.. poetry run ogscm compiler.py ogs.py -B -C -R --ogs ../..
--build_args ' --progress=plain' --build_args ' --progress=plain'
--pm system --cvode --ccache --pm system --cvode --ccache
--cmake_args ' -DBUILD_TESTING=OFF -DOGS_BUILD_UTILS=ON -DOGS_USE_PYTHON=ON' --cmake_args ' -DBUILD_TESTING=OFF -DOGS_BUILD_UTILS=ON -DOGS_USE_PYTHON=ON'
--tag $CI_REGISTRY/ogs/$CI_PROJECT_NAME/ogs-serial:latest --upload $DOCKER_TAG
- > - >
poetry run ogscm compiler.py mpi.py ogs.py -B -C -R --ogs ../.. poetry run ogscm compiler.py mpi.py ogs.py -B -C -R --ogs ../..
--build_args ' --progress=plain' --build_args ' --progress=plain'
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ment